Paper Title: Agentic AI for Vulnerability Management in Cloud-Native Enterprise Architectures
Authors Name: Saurabh Mishra

Abstract: The evolution of complex security challenges has rendered traditional vulnerability management techniques increasingly ineffective with the growing adoption of cloud-native enterprise architectures. The article is a literature review of the emergence of agentic artificial intelligence (AI) and its implementation as a revolution in the management of vulnerabilities in such dynamic environments. The agentic AIs are context sensitive, autonomous, and adaptive in the decision-making processes and are scalable in their capability to offer proactive security solutions, which can be changed to suit the dynamism of the enterprise IT infrastructures. The architecture, adaptive security models, privacy-sensitive models, threat analysis techniques, and commercial applications of agentic AI in cloud-native services will be discussed in the paper. It also unveils the fact that synergies in high-performance computing (HPC) can further enhance the capability of agentic AI agents in real-time security analytics. Building on the recent sources and the example of technical surveys and industry implementation, the review proposes Agentic AI as an enabler of resilient, intelligent, and autonomous vulnerability management in the modern-day ecosystem of the enterprise.
Keywords: Agentic AI, Vulnerability Management, Cloud-Native Architecture, Enterprise Security
